  • Patent number: 4886492
    Abstract: A surgical suction tip comprises a tubular body portion with a hollow tip portion at one end communicating into the body portion, and a cap portion releasably closing the other end, a tubular connecting portion mounted externally on the cap portion communicating through the cap portion into the body portion. A hollow filter member within the body portion defines an annular chamber between the filter member and the body portion and communicating with the tubular connecting portion through the cap portion, a plurality of apertures in the filter member connecting the interior of the filter member with the annular chamber. The body portion has locating means thereon locating one end of the filter member within the body portion, while the other end of the filter member is closed. Waste material flows from the tip portion into the hollow interior of the filter member and then to the annular chamber and to the tubular connecting portion.

  • Patent number: 4881626
    Abstract: A power transmission apparatus for a four-wheel drive vehicle has a first rotary shaft for transmitting drive force to front wheels of the vehicle, a second rotary shaft for transmitting drive force to rear wheels of the vehicle, and a hydraulic pump connecting the first and second rotary shafts and driven by a difference in rotational speed between the first and second rotary shafts to deliver hydraulic oil in an amount depending on the difference in rotational speed. A suction passage and a delivery passage is changed over in dependence on relative rotational direction of the first and second rotary shafts. An expansion chamber communicates with the suction passages and delivery through a restriction to temporarily suppress an increase in pressure of hydraulic oil delivered from the hydraulic pump, thereby suppressing transmission of a drive force by the hydraulic pump when the variation in relative rotation speed between the first and second rotary shafts is small.

  • Patent number: 4862814
    Abstract: A burner which is suitable for use in combusting pulverized coal and which can be used as an igniter for igniting the main burners in steam raising plant. The burner has an electrically powered torch which generates a continuous plasma which extends into a devolatilization zone of the burner, and primary conduits are provided for directing a primary supply of dense phase pulverized coal into the devolatilization zone. The burner is constructed also to include a combustion zone which surrounds the devolatilization zone. The burner is constructed also to include a comubstion zone which surrounds the devolatilization zone, and secondary conduits are provided for directing a secondary supply of pulverized coal into the combustion zone along with a supply of combustion supporting air.

  • Patent number: 4863865
    Abstract: Material which contains water, or is accompanied by an aqueous phase, notably biological cells, cell components or cell aggregates, or differentiated biological tissue is preserved by dispersion in an oil medium and under-cooling the dispersion, preferably to a temperature in the range -20.degree. C. to -40.degree. C. The oil medium is characterized by the absence of surfactant which can catalyze ice formation and is an immobile gel at the storage temperature. The preferred oil 10 medium is paraffin oil, or oil plus paraffin wax.
